Как вносить данные в SQL: полезные советы и рекомендации
Как вносить данные в SQL?
В SQL данные можно вносить с помощью оператора INSERT. Оператор INSERT позволяет вставить новую строку в таблицу.
Вот пример:
INSERT INTO table_name(column1, column2, column3)
VALUES(value1, value2, value3);
Здесь table_name - название таблицы, column1, column2, column3 - названия столбцов, а value1, value2, value3 - значения для соответствующих столбцов.
Например, если у нас есть таблица "students" с колонками "id", "name" и "age", и мы хотим внести нового студента, мы можем сделать это следующим образом:
INSERT INTO students(id, name, age)
VALUES(1, 'John Doe', 20);
В этом примере мы вносим нового студента с id равным 1, именем "John Doe" и возрастом 20.
Детальный ответ
Как вносить данные в SQL
Добро пожаловать в увлекательный мир SQL! В этой статье я покажу вам, как вносить данные в SQL базу данных. Я предоставлю вам подробную информацию и примеры кода, чтобы вы могли лучше понять этот процесс.
1. Использование команды INSERT
Одним из наиболее распространенных способов внесения данных в SQL базу данных является использование команды INSERT. Синтаксис этой команды выглядит следующим образом:
INSERT INTO table_name (column1, column2, column3, ...)
VALUES (value1, value2, value3, ...);
Вы должны указать имя таблицы (table_name), в которую вы хотите внести данные, а также имена столбцов (column1, column2, column3, ...), в которые вы хотите внести значения. Затем вы должны указать значения (value1, value2, value3, ...) для каждого столбца.
Давайте представим, что у нас есть таблица "users" с столбцами "id", "name" и "age". Чтобы добавить нового пользователя в эту таблицу, мы можем использовать следующую команду:
INSERT INTO users (name, age)
VALUES ('John Doe', 25);
В этом примере мы добавляем пользователя с именем "John Doe" и возрастом 25 лет в таблицу "users".
2. Внесение данных через приложение
Кроме того, данные могут быть внесены в SQL базу данных с помощью приложения, написанного на языке программирования, который поддерживает работу с базами данных, таким как Python, Java или PHP. Для этого вы можете использовать SQL запросы и соответствующие библиотеки, чтобы установить подключение к базе данных и выполнить необходимые операции.
Ниже приведен пример кода на Python, который позволяет внести данные в SQL базу данных:
import mysql.connector
# Установка подключения к базе данных
mydb = mysql.connector.connect(
host="localhost",
user="yourusername",
password="yourpassword",
database="yourdatabase"
)
# Создание курсора
cursor = mydb.cursor()
# SQL запрос для внесения данных
sql = "INSERT INTO users (name, age) VALUES (%s, %s)"
values = ("John Doe", 25)
# Выполнение SQL запроса
cursor.execute(sql, values)
# Подтверждение изменений в базе данных
mydb.commit()
print(cursor.rowcount, "строка добавлена.")
В этом примере мы используем библиотеку mysql.connector для установки подключения к базе данных MySQL. Затем мы создаем курсор, который позволяет нам выполнять SQL запросы.
Мы определяем SQL запрос в переменной "sql" и используем знаки %s в качестве заполнителей для значений, которые будут добавлены в запрос. Мы также определяем значения в переменной "values", которые будут подставлены в запрос. Выполнение SQL запроса и подтверждение изменений происходит через соответствующие функции.
3. Использование SQL инструментов
Еще один способ внести данные в SQL базу данных - использовать SQL инструменты, такие как MySQL Workbench или phpMyAdmin. Эти инструменты предоставляют графический интерфейс, который облегчает вставку данных в таблицы.
Для добавления данных через MySQL Workbench вы можете открыть соответствующую таблицу, щелкнуть кнопку "Insert" и заполнить значения в соответствующие столбцы. Затем нажмите кнопку "Apply" или "Execute" для сохранения изменений.
Аналогичным образом, в phpMyAdmin вы можете выбрать таблицу, перейти на вкладку "Insert", заполнить значения и нажать кнопку "Go" для сохранения внесенных изменений.
Заключение
В данной статье мы рассмотрели различные способы внесения данных в SQL базу данных. Мы начали с использования команды INSERT, которая является стандартным способом для внесения данных. Затем мы рассмотрели возможность использования приложения на языке программирования, чтобы внести данные через SQL запросы.
Также мы кратко ознакомились с использованием SQL инструментов, которые предоставляют графический интерфейс для более удобной работы с базой данных.
Уверен, что теперь вы освоили основы внесения данных в SQL базу данных. Помните, что практика - лучший способ улучшить свои навыки, поэтому не стесняйтесь экспериментировать с различными способами ввода данных и задавать вопросы, если у вас возникают затруднения. Удачи!